Living in Mission Dolores

Mission Dolores is the historic heart of San Francisco — the neighborhood around Mission San Francisco de Asís (Mission Dolores), the 1791 adobe that is the oldest standing building in the city. Today it’s a graceful, highly desirable central neighborhood of well-preserved Victorian and Edwardian homes and flats, sitting in the sunny pocket between the Mission, the Castro, and Duboce Triangle. It blends deep history with one of the best lifestyles in the city: walkable, central, and sunny.

Its crown jewel is Dolores Park — the city’s favorite sunny gathering spot — with the restaurants and cafés of Valencia Street, the Castro, and 18th Street all within easy walking distance.

History, Parks & Landmarks

  • Mission Dolores (Mission San Francisco de Asís)
    The 1791 adobe mission — the oldest standing building in San Francisco — and its basilica · 3321 16th St
  • Dolores Park
    The city’s beloved sunny park — lawns, palm-lined promenade, playground, and skyline views · 19th & Dolores
  • Valencia & 18th Street dining
    Two of the city’s best restaurant corridors, with the Castro and Mission both at hand

Fun Facts About Mission Dolores

  • Mission Dolores (1791) is the oldest standing structure in San Francisco and the namesake of the entire Mission District.
  • Dolores Park sits in one of the sunniest microclimates in the city, with one of its best skyline views.
  • The neighborhood’s Victorians survived the 1906 quake, which spared this part of the city.
  • The mission’s small cemetery is one of only two remaining within city limits.
